Sunrise Hitek Introduces Heavy-Duty iPad Case with Armor Plate Cover, Made for Schools
Chicago, IL (PRWEB) April 17, 2015 -- Sunrise Hitek is pleased to introduce their fifth generation rugged iPad case https://www.sunrisehitek.com/product/ipad-slim-tough-case-g5 which features a handy additional armor plate folio cover that completely eliminates broken screens. Other highlights include a dual-layer rugged design including a protective silicone skin over an inner hard case and a naked frame for the very best touch experience, which is 100% stylus compatible. The Built-in stylus glides smoothly on the glass screen and keeps it clean. Handy magnetic closure keeps the folio cover shut when closed and the strong kickstand with stainless steel pins provides superb stability.
Their new model for iPad Air 2 will still provide all the features of the other fifth generation slim tough iPad cases, https://www.sunrisehitek.com/product/ipad-slim-tough-case-g5 but additionally is compatible with iPad Air 2’s fingerprint scanner. The G5 case is compatible with many charging carts, including the Bretford, Anthro, Datamation, Ergotron, and others once the folio cover is removed. Like previous generations, this case is available in (8) bright colors and mixed-color orders still receive bulk quantity discount. This model also boasts two asset tag windows. Optional full-color customization with logo artwork and tracking barcode is a great option for schools and sales representatives.
About Sunrise Hitek
Sunrise Hitek’s üuber store, formerly known as iGear, is a leading maker of protective gear for Apple’s iPad. The brand changed to üuber when the company starting developing cases for other devices, such as the MacBook, Chromebook, and Samsung devices. Sunrise Hitek Group, LLC, owner of the üuber brand, also operates Sunrise Digital, a leading digital printing company based in Chicago. As a G7 Qualified Master Printer, Sunrise is uniquely qualified among protective gear makers to offer a wide array of customization options, ensuring the most consistent and accurate color reproduction. Sunrise is an Inc. 5000 company established in 1988 and employs the most advanced equipment and technology, such as G7-certified HP Indigo and UV flatbed presses, and digital die-cutting, to create best-in-class products. A privately-owned enterprise, the company is based in Chicago and sells products worldwide.
